The functionality of the TPN/TPS system remains unchanged, but allows independent usage of two types of control networks Universal Control Network (UCN) based on IEEE 802.4 coax based technology Enhanced Universal Control Network (EUCN) based on IEEE 802.3 Ethernet applying FTE The TPN/TPS system comprises several different integrated hardware and software solutions that support a wide range of application needs. Figure 1 represents a subset of the possible nodes and controllers
In order to take advantage of FTE, the older IEEE 802.4 interfaces on the Network Interface Module (NIM) and HPM were redesigned to connect to Ethernet (IEEE 802.3) based FTE. These redesigned interfaces along with the use of Ethernet cables are the basis of the EUCN (Figure 2)..
For FTE connectivity: The EHPM has new Communications and Control Assembly and its associated EHPM FTE Interface Assembly (see). The ENIM has new EPNI2 Assembly and its associated EPNI2 I/O Assembly A minimal EUCN network (see Figure ) consists, at a minimum, of two nodes (the ENIM and EHPM) connected by FTE media (Copper/Fiber optic Ethernet cables attached to a Honeywell Control Firewall). Larger networks incorporate Level 2 FTE switches and other (typically redundant) ENIMs and EHPMs.
Depending on the “routed cable” communication distance, EUCN uses fiber optic cables and shielded copper cables to ensure reliable operation in high noise industrial environments. FTE network security is achieved through the use of Level 1 Honeywell Control Firewall and Level 2 Industrial Ethernet switch configurations.
